Pet

Other (objects, etc.) entity

The protagonist has or can have (usually one) animal companion that is not an integral part of the story or gameplay.

Alternate name: Pet system

Without companion tag, these can be assumed to help with the player with things the protagonist can do even alone, but the pet makes them somewhat easier. That is to say, the pet is not necessary.

Unlike companions pets can be replaced usually quite easily and do not cause game over if they die.
Related:
* Companion - in case the pet is integral to the story or gameplay.
* Minions - in case you can have a number of pets or other lesser creatures helping you, usually these exist only briefly unlike pets.
